Brief Summary
This study evaluates the safety and effectiveness of Ciprofol, a new sedative, in critically ill patients receiving Extracorporeal Membrane Oxygenation (ECMO), a life-support system for heart or lung ...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Receiving ECMO therapy with an anticipated duration exceeding 72 hours;
- Requiring invasive mechanical ventilation;
- Requiring sedation and analgesia treatment.
Exclusion
- BMI \>45 kg/m²;
- Age \<18 years;
- Severe hepatic (Child-Pugh Class C) or renal failure (eGFR \<15 mL/min/1.73m²);
- History of severe psychiatric disorders;
- Pregnancy;
- Refusal to sign informed consent;
- Contraindications to midazolam and propofol use.
